#56ebe2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56ebe2 is composed of 33.7% red, 92.2%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.8%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 176.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 62.9%. #56ebe2 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#00d7c5.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#56ebe2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010606 is the darkest color, while #f4f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#56ebe2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9fa2a2 is the less saturated color, while #47faef is the most saturated one.
